Elderly men with low levels of testosterone or other sex hormones have twice the likelihood of having declining physical function over two years' time compared with their peers who have the highest hormone levels, a new study finds. "This study suggests that low testosterone in older men could lead to a decline in muscle strength, which might explain their increased risk of functional disability," one researcher said.
